摘要
由于238 U裂变反应率在中国实验快堆(CEFR)中是一非常关键的指标参数,因此,在CEFR的首次物理启动工作中对其进行了实验测量。在实验过程中,利用高贫化的UO2(235 U-0.002%)直接进行了238 U裂变反应率的绝对测量;利用国产贫铀片(235 U-0.335%)、高浓铀片(235 U-90%)组合方式间接进行了238 U裂变反应率的测量。给出两种方法与理论值的对比和轴向及径向的相对分布。本实验为238 U裂变反应率测量提出一新的选择方案,并验证了其可靠性。
China Experimental Fast Reactor(CEFR) is the first fast reactor in China.It experimented on CEFR to measure the 238U fission reaction rate in the first physics startup tests because of its fundamentality.The experiment was composed of the absolute measurement by the high poor uranium(235U-0.002%) and the indirect measurement by the national poor uranium(235U-0.335%) and the high enrichment uranium(235U-90%).The axial distribution and the radial distribution were given and compared with the theoretical value.The reliability was proved and a new way was found to measure the 238U fission reaction rate.
